在C語(yǔ)??言中,語(yǔ)言中e指數可以使用(yong)數學(xué)庫中的(de)數表示exp()函數來(lái)表示,exp()函數位于math.h頭文件中,語(yǔ)言中用于計算e的數表示x次方,為了使用exp()函數,語(yǔ)言中我們需要先引入math.h頭文件,數表示然后調用exp()函數并傳入相應(ying)的語(yǔ)言中參(′▽?zhuān)?)數。
(圖片來(lái)源網(wǎng)絡(luò ),數表示侵刪(°o°))以下是語(yǔ)言中一個(gè)簡(jiǎn)單的示例,演示了如何在C語(yǔ)言中使用e指數:
#include <stdio.h>#include <math.h>int main() { double x = 2.0; // 定義一個(gè)雙精度浮點(diǎn)數變量x,數表示并賦值為2.0 double result = exp(x); // 調用exp()函數,語(yǔ)言中計算e的數表示x次方,并將結果存儲在(zai)result變量中 printf("e的語(yǔ)言中%.1f次方等于: %.6f", x, result(???)); // 輸出結果 return 0;}在這個(gè)示例中,我們首先引入了stdio.h和math.h頭文件,??數表示我們定義了一個(gè)雙精度浮點(diǎn)數變量x,語(yǔ)言中并將其賦??值為2.0,接下來(lái),我們調用exp()函數,將x作為參數傳入,計算e的x次方,并將結果存儲在result變(°o°)量中,我們使用printf()函數輸(′▽?zhuān)?出結果。
注意:在使用exp()函數之前,需(xu)要確保已經(jīng)包含了math.h頭文件,由于exp()??函數返回的是雙精度浮點(diǎn)數,因此我們需要將結果存儲在一個(gè)雙精度浮點(diǎn)數(shu)變量中。
除了exp()函數之外,C語(yǔ)言還提供了其他一些數學(xué)函數,如si(′?_?`)n()、cos()、sqrt()等(deng),這些函數同樣位于math.h頭文件中,要使用(╯°□°)╯這些函數,只需引入math.h頭文件,然后調用相應的函數即可,要計算sin(30)(′?`)的值,可以使用以下(xia)代碼:
#include <stdio.h>#include <math.h>int main() { double angle = 30.0; // 定義一個(gè)雙精度浮點(diǎn)數變量angle,并賦值為30.0 double result = sin(angle * M_PI / 180.0); // 調用sin()函數??,計算sin(angle)的值,并將結果存儲在result變量中 printf??("sin(%.1f)等于: %.6f??", angle, result); // 輸出結果 return 0;}在這個(gè)示例中,我們首先引入了stdio.h和math.h頭文件,我們定義了一個(gè)雙精度浮點(diǎn)數變量angle,并將其賦值為30.0,接下來(lái),我們調用sin()函數,將angle乘以π除以180的結果作(?⊿?)為參數傳(chuan)入(⊙_⊙),計算sin(angle)的值?,并將結果存儲在result變量中,我們使用printf()函數(shu)輸出結果。
注意:在調用sin()、cos()等三角函數時(shí),需要將角度值轉(zhuan)換為弧度值,為此,我們可以使用M_PI常量(位于math.h頭文件中)來(lái)計算π的值,在本例中,(╯‵□′)╯我們將angle乘以π除以180的結果作為參數傳入sin()函數,這樣,我們就可以計算出sin(30)的值了。
在C語(yǔ)言中,我們可以使用(yong)數學(xué)庫中的exp()函數來(lái)計算e的┐(′?`)┌x次方,為了使用這個(gè)函數,我們需要先引入math.h頭文件,然后調用ex?p()函數并傳入相應的參數,C語(yǔ)言還提供了其他一些數學(xué)函數,如sin()、cos()、sqrt()等,這些函數同樣位于math.h頭文件中,要使用這些函數,只需引入mat(╬?益?)h.h頭文件,然后調用相應( ?ヮ?)的函數即??可。


網(wǎng)站二維碼
導航
電話(huà)
短信
咨詢(xún)
地圖
分享